DiAnoia's Eatery Pittsburgh Reviews from The Last Year
Nice ambiance and service but the food is mediocre to less than that
The artichoke appetizer was very ample but I thought it would be made of fresh, roasted artichokes, unfortunately they were marinated or canned or pickled. The mussels were almost raw, tasteless and cold. The gnocchi was made from an era of people who don’t know what real gnocchi tastes like, a little dumpling just flipped off the fork that has just the right size to absorb the sauce. The sauce was marginal. The meatball was awful. The veal was the best part of the dinner. Just stopped in for a good meal and left dissatisfied enough to write a review, which I almost never do.

My friend and I recently dined at Dianoia's and embarked on
My friend and I recently dined at Dianoia's and embarked on a delightful culinary adventure. We kicked off our meal with two appetizers: the escarole, beans, and sausage, and the nduja cheese & pesto aioli. While the escarole, beans, and sausage dish was bursting with flavor, it leaned slightly towards the salty side for my taste. Conversely, the nduja cheese & pesto aioli was a true delight, boasting a perfect balance of crispness and spices. Moving on to our entrees, we savored the gnocchi bread bowl and the chicken alla bosciolla. While the gnocchi bread bowl made a stunning presentation, its flavor profile leaned towards the standard side. However, the chicken alla bosciolla stole the show with its tender meat and decadent, savory sauce. Overall, our experience at Dianoia's left us with positive impressions. With its inviting ambiance and attentive service, Dianoia's stands out as a top choice for Italian cuisine in Pittsburgh.

Don’t forget your Earplugs
Drinks were ok , beans and greens had a lot of flavor but not many greens 😕. Shrimp with capellini was very bland and I can swear the shrimp were already precooked and tossed into pasta😖.Sauce was ok ,meatballs were meaty ,gnocchi were good. Menu is ala cart , salad is extra, baked dough “ Bread “ was good for 9 dollars extra . You do not get a basket of bread for the table. The most annoying park of that two hour meal , service was very slow on a busy weekday nite and very very very loud in dining area. There is sound absorbing panels on walls , but at no avail. Bring earplugs, sad but true.

Working on your bid? |
Your bid has been “matched” with a reservation. From the time a reservation has been located, the seller of the reservation must connect with moderator to give transfer information for reservation. If the seller;however, does NOT respond to reservation transfer, then your bid is reprocessed and returns to the first step, which is connecting your request to a reservation.

Where do the Reservations on AppointmentTrader come from? |
Mostly from people who don't need their reservations or appointments any longer. AT has no relationship with places listed and acts as a platform connecting buyers and sellers making sure that listed reservations are real and that privacy is not compromised when transacting.
What happens if my bid expires unanswered? |
Hey @FluffyStar64, thanks for the question! When you place your bid the amount gets transferred in a deposit account, the second you either cancel your bid or a few minutes after the bid expires the funds are moved back into your main account from where you can refund it to your payment method or use for other transactions.

Give the best answerHonest review of AT and advice to new joiners
Forget trying to snipe reservations online by waking up early and booking top restaurants at Carbone or Tatiana or Cote or 4Charles. After 2.5 months of booking reservations by setting up alarms, waking up early to sell appointments. It’s very hard to cash out on this app. During cash out, you have to pay $5 fee +3% transactions fee and max payout per day is $150.
Advice to new users:
- do not mass book reservations
- fill bids only
- don’t try to book reservations online, you need connections and call the restaurant
After putting in about 40 hours of work, I’ve made about $750 sale on this platform but gotten paid $0. Take this with a grain of salt.
